Take the Exams

Most of our certifications require a written and a practical exam. You can take the written exam through three modalities (OPT, EOT, or TCT), and the practical exam is administered by CCO-credentialed proctors. Results are available immediately upon completion.

Get Certified

Upon passing the required exams for certification, certifications are issued within 10 business days. Your employer can view your certifications through VerifyCCO, and you can share them via email or on social media in the myCCO portal!

CCO written exams are computer-based and multiple-choice. They assess your knowledge of safe crane operation, load charts, rigging, signaling, and site safety for your certification program.

Preliminary results are shown on screen immediately after you finish, so you’ll know how you did before you leave.

Three Ways to Take Your Written Exam

Each modality has its own advantages — choose the one that fits your situation best.

OPT

Online Proctored Testing

Take your exam from home or office on your own computer, monitored by a live remote proctor.

Key Benefits

  • Test from virtually anywhere — no travel required
  • Flexible scheduling, including evenings and weekends
  • Immediate preliminary results on screen
  • Ideal for individual candidates

EOT

Event Online Testing

Test at an approved host site or company event, administered by your own credentialed CCO testing personnel.

Key Benefits

  • Test many candidates at one location
  • Run on your own schedule and site
  • Administered by your credentialed staff
  • Immediate preliminary results

TCT

Test Center Testing

Take your exam in person at an approved third-party testing center near you.

Key Benefits

  • Professional, distraction-free environment
  • No computer setup on your end
  • Hundreds of locations nationwide
  • Great if you lack a compatible home computer

CCO practical exams are hands-on assessments administered by a credentialed Practical Examiner. You’ll perform a series of defined tasks on the equipment to demonstrate safe, competent operation.

Practical exams are conducted at approved test sites with the appropriate equipment and load.

cco cert, crane operator, crane operator in cab

01 Find a Practical Proctor

Locate a CCO-credentialed Practical Proctor to administer your exam and contact them to schedule your test date.

02 Apply

Apply in the myCCO portal and receive your authorization code to give to the proctor on the day of the exam.

03 Test Day

Give your Practical Proctor the authorization code from the confirmation email you received and your exam will be administered.

Most CCO certifications are valid for five years and require a written exam to recertify. A few programs, like Telehandler, run on a three-year cycle, and some — including Signalperson and Telehandler — also require a practical exam to recertify. Check your certification’s expiration date and requirements in the myCCO portal.
